**Q: Builds on Forgeline agents fail with "timestamp in future" errors — what now?**

A: Clock skew between agents in the Dunmere pool. Restart the time-sync daemon on the affected agent and requeue the build. Don't adjust clocks manually. If skew exceeds five seconds across multiple agents, escalate to the platform team at the address below.

billing contact of baweg-bahif = kelmir_prair_eliael@nelvroworks.internal

**Mgmt Meeting Minutes — Retiring the Brightline Range**

Quick recap for sales leads at Fenholt Supplies: we agreed to retire the Brightline fixture range by year-end. Remaining stock moves to clearance pricing next month, and accounts on standing orders get migrated to the Lumetta range. Trade-in incentives were approved in principle. The confidential note on next steps sits just below.

board note of bajof-bajeg: The pricing group signed off on a budget of $13.4 million for Project Sildor. The renewal with Lamixek Holdings closes at $48.9 million a year, 49 percent above the last contract.

### Runbook: Report export timezone mismatches (Glimmerfield)

If a customer reports that exported totals differ from the dashboard, check whether their report schedule predates the March cutover — older schedules still render in server-local time rather than the account timezone. Re-saving the schedule fixes it. Before escalating, confirm the export worker is running with the expected timezone settings shown below.

config for kadup-kajog:
[raldor]
host = raldor.tolvaqworks.internal
user = raldor_svc
database = raldor_prod